MetLife Pet Insurance today announced the creation of the Golden Beagle Award. This award will recognize an animal welfare organization for its innovative approach to addressing the challenges of helping larger dogs find loving homes. The recipient will receive $20,000 to put toward their work. The award is part of MetLife Pet Insurance's collaboration with The Association for Animal Welfare Advancement (AAWA), a cohort of leaders on a mission to champion, advance, and unify the animal welfare profession. CLAIMS STORY: Sara, an 8-year-old Golden Retriever, presented to the ER after ingesting 11 tablets of Carprofen that evening. Carprofen is an anti-inflammatory medication specifically for dogs. Sometimes, manufacturers will make the Carprofen tablets flavored, so it is easier to give the medicine. Unfortunately, some dogs, like Sara, may think they are treats! The dose of Carprofen Sara ingested is potentially toxic to internal organs, so quick action was imperative. Happily, after 3 days of hospitalization, Sara was discharged and is doing well! We were able to cover $1,896.85 out of the incident’s total of $2,369.28! (This example is for illustrative purposes only. This is based on a policy with a $100 deductible and 90% reimbursement.
